At Unity of Sheboygan, your children can develop a healthy relationship with God, learn positive values, share their feelings, communicate with one another and develop a healthy self image.  Lessons are designed to start children on their path of spiritual discovery and to the power of Christ within.  Music, crafts, games and other activities are designed to support the positive thoughts and success of each child, self-love and confidnece and embrace life's diversity.

                                 NURSERY CARE
                                 
(0-3 year olds)

Babies & infants, ages 0-3, have Nursery care provided during our time of service.  Our focus is on age-appropriate play and providing a secure, loving environment.




                                     UNIKIDS
                             (5 to 11 year olds)

Children five to eleven years of age attend the UniKIds class.  A variety of curricula are utilized to provide children the opportunity to experience their divine qualities.  The program relies on the use of affirmations, children's storybooks, bible passages, games,music, meditation, role-plays and crafts to help children explore Unity principles in practice.


                                  UNITOTS
                          (under 5 years of age)


Infants & children under five years of age are cared for in a warm and nurturing environment.  Caregivers model and encourage behavior that reflects the child's divine nature.

Music is used to teach simple concepts (such as "This little light of mine, I'm gonna let it shine!").  Positive affirmations are discussed and rehearsed
.
                                    UNITEENS
                              (12-14 year olds)

Youngsters twelve to fourteen years of age participate in the UniTeens class.  Various curricula are utilized to explore issues of particular interest to adolescents.  Lessons strive to empower teens with the spiritual wisdom to fulfill their soul's purpose in everyday life.  Teens discuss issues related to the world "out there" and their "inner selves".  Open discussion, affirmation, meditation, prayer and study are used to provide teens with the tools for practical spirituality.
